Do you happen to know whether you’ve been listed as Category 2 or Category 3 for your DIEP surgery?
There aren’t official statistics specific to DIEP procedures, but the wait times you mention do align with what we have heard across Vic for Category 3 patients in the public system. While Category 3 surgeries are intended to occur within 12 months, in practice they are often delayed.
Here’s a general overview of how categories are assigned:
Each hospital may apply these categories slightly differently, but they follow national guidelines.
If you’re unsure of your category, it’s worth checking with your treating specialist or hospital — especially if something has changed, as they may be able to reassess/clarify your urgency level.
